RPC IV.1, 10891 (temporary)

 

Image of specimen #1

 

Coin type
Volume IV.1
Number 10891 (temporary)
Province Achaea
Region Boeotia
City Tanagra
Reign Marcus Aurelius
Person (obv.) Commodus (Caesar)
Dating 175–177
Obverse inscription ΑΥΡ ΚοΜΟΔ[ΟϹ] ΚΑΙϹΑΡ
Obverse design bare-headed bust of Commodus (youthful) wearing paludamentum, right
Reverse inscription ΤΑΝΑΓΡΑΙωΝ
Reverse design Apollo(?) standing, facing, head, left, holding laurel branch (or arrow?) and bow
Metal copper-based alloy
Average diameter 19 mm
